原文:藍牙speaker配對流程源碼分析

這篇文章簡單分析一下 藍牙音箱配對流程.現在的音箱基本都支持security simple pairing.所以這里的流程基本上就是ssp的代碼流程. 源碼參考的是 Android . 上面的bluedroid.這里先介紹一些bluedroid定義的概率. 首先介紹一下 配對的幾個狀態:pairing cb.state ,這個定義在bluetooth.h里面. 每次有配對狀態發生改變的時候,通過b ...

2019-01-08 23:24 0 1507 推薦指數:

查看詳情

android 藍牙源碼分析

BluetoothService類中定義的Native方法都在android_server_BluetoothServer.cpp里建立jni調用 一、開啟(BT Turn on Turn off) (藍牙的打開關閉由類BluetoothEnabler控制。)1. ...

Thu Jul 26 23:24:00 CST 2012 0 3654
藍牙Remove Bond的流程分析

此篇文章簡單分析一下藍牙解除配對在協議棧中的工作流程分析的協議棧版本是Android8.0 協議棧的接口都定義在bluetooth.cc這個文件中: 這里需要注意一下bt_bdaddr_t 是一個結構體,內部一個元素是數組。 進入 ...

Mon Jun 18 06:14:00 CST 2018 0 1256
4 藍牙耳機配對模式

4 藍牙耳機配對模式經過上面幾個步驟之后,可以幾乎解決百分之百的藍牙連接問題。本人也成功地可以在添加設備的界面中看到很多的藍牙設備。BTW,電腦始終搜索不到我的藍牙耳機。經過多方努力,本人終於發現原來是自己對藍牙耳機的操作問題。 對於藍牙耳機,第一次配對的時候在關機狀態下按下電源鍵2s左右,配對 ...

Thu Feb 27 03:02:00 CST 2020 0 697
雙系統藍牙配對問題

最近給新筆記本電腦裝了win10+ubuntu16雙系統,發現原來在win10下已經配對藍牙鼠標,在ubuntu下配對后,win10就不能用了,需要重新配對才行,反之亦然。 每次切換系統后藍牙鼠標都要重新配對真的好麻煩,參考《Ubuntu win10共享藍牙鼠標》實現 ...

Tue Jul 14 17:52:00 CST 2020 0 975
android 藍牙app(搜索、配對

  功能:搜索附近的藍牙設備(僅限於經典藍牙)並顯示、對指定的藍牙設備發送配對請求、獲取已配對藍牙設備名稱、對指定的藍牙設備取消配對。   android 藍牙app(搜索、配對) - Chi4ki - 博客園 (cnblogs.com) AndroidManifests.xml ...

Thu Apr 07 05:03:00 CST 2022 0 831
SpringBoot-自動裝配對象及源碼ImportSelector分析

SpringBoot框架已經很流行了,筆者做項目也一直在用,使用久了,越來越覺得有必要理解SpringBoot框架中的一些原理了,目前的面試幾乎都會用問到底層原理。我們在使用過程中基本上是搭建有 ...

Fri Jun 21 17:36:00 CST 2019 0 934
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M